Hung Hom (紅磡) is a subdistrict North East of Tsim Sha Tsui in the Kowloon City District. It overlooks Kowloon Bay and comprises a mix of mainly residential and industrial buildings. Notable places of interest include the Hong Kong Polytechnic University, the grand Hong Kong Coliseum and the artistic Senso Italiano gallery, the Hung Hom Ferry Pier, Wonderful Worlds of Whampoa shopping mall and Hung Hom Square. Notable buildings include the Jockey Club Innovation Tower and the Kwun Yam Temple.
